Embodiment 1

[0027] Weigh 9.0g of fusidic acid solid, add absolute ethanol, heat to 45°C, after dissolving, add 4M aqueous sodium hydroxide solution under stirring, the molar ratio of added sodium hydroxide to fusidic acid is 0.8:1 to obtain 25ml of sodium fusidate solution; control the temperature at 20°C, add ethyl acetate solution under stirring, the flow rate is 25ml / h, when the amount of ethyl acetate is 375ml, stop feeding, Stir for another 0.5 h, filter with suction, and dry the filter cake at 35° C. for 36 h to obtain 8.3 g of sodium fusidate crystals. After testing its X-ray powder diffraction pattern is as follows figure 1 shown. As determined by HPLC, its purity was 99.83%. The yield was 88.46%.

Embodiment 2

[0029] Weigh 9.0g of fusidic acid solid, dissolve it in absolute ethanol at 40°C, add 4M aqueous sodium hydroxide solution under stirring, and the molar ratio of added sodium hydroxide to fusidic acid is 1:1 , to obtain 30ml of sodium fusidate solution; control the temperature at 25°C, add ethyl acetate solution under stirring state, when the flow rate is 510ml, after the addition is completed, stir for 1h, filter with suction, and place the filter cake at 40°C After drying for 42 hours, 8.7 g of sodium fusidate crystals were obtained. After testing its X-ray powder diffraction pattern is as follows figure 1 shown. As determined by HPLC, its purity was 99.98%. The yield was 92.72%.

Embodiment 3

[0031] Weigh 9.0 g of fusidic acid solids, dissolve and clarify it with absolute ethanol at 35° C., and add 4 M aqueous sodium hydroxide solution under stirring. The molar ratio of added sodium hydroxide to fusidic acid is 1.2:1, to obtain 35ml of sodium fusidate solution; control the temperature at 40°C, add ethyl acetate solution under stirring, the flow rate is 35ml / h, when the amount of ethyl acetate is 700ml, stop feeding, Stir again for 1.5h, filter with suction, place the filter cake at 45°C and dry for 48h to obtain 8.5g of sodium fusidate crystals, whose X-ray powder diffraction pattern is as follows: figure 1 shown. As determined by HPLC, the purity was 99.89%, and the yield was 90.59%.

Abstract

The invention relates to a sodium fusidate crystal and a preparation method thereof. The X-ray powder diffraction spectrum characteristic peaks of the sodium fusidate crystal newly provided by the invention, represented by 2theta+/-0.2 degrees, are at 6.960, 7.117, 8.180, 8.355, 11.895, 14.460, 15.176, 16.389, 16.574, 24.837, 28.967 and 36.344. The preparation method comprises the following steps of: 1) dissolving fusidic acid in a low alcohol solution to obtain a sodium fusidate solution; 2) feeding an ethyl acetate solution into the sodium fusidate solution to crystallize sodium fusidate, and collecting a solid phase; and 3) drying the solid phase, thus obtaining a sodium fusidate crystal. The sodium fusidate crystal provided by the invention has the advantages of being glittering and translucent in appearance, uniform in granule, stable in crystal form, favorable for sub-package and storage, and the like. The method provided by the invention has the advantages that the prepared sodium fusidate crystal is good in stability, the process is simple in process and environment-friendly, and the adopted solvent is reusable and recoverable, low in production cost and the like.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a compound crystal and a preparation method thereof, more specifically relates to a sodium fusidate crystal and a preparation method thereof. Background technique [0002] Fusidate Sodium (Fusidate Sodium, trade name Lisidine) is the sodium salt of Fusidic acid (Fusidate acid), which was first obtained from the shuttle in the fermentation broth by Leo Pharmaceutical Products of Denmark in 1962. Extracted from the fungus streptosporic liposome, which belongs to the class of fusidic acid antibiotics. Sodium fusidate is a brand-new antibiotic, which is applied to various infections caused by various sensitive bacteria, especially staphylococcus, such as osteomyelitis, sepsis, endocarditis, surgical and traumatic infections, etc. At the same time, it has good safety, and its toxicity is low, and allergic reactions are rare.
